The controversy originated in a teacher's claim for $400 additional annual salary because she had a master's degree. The claim is for seven years commencing with the 1972-1973 school year through 1978-1979. A grievance was not filed until June 18, 1980. Respondent demanded arbitration on July 18, 1980, whereupon petitioner commenced this CPLR article 75 proceeding for a stay.
